The Cutoff Points for students entering high education institutions under a remedial program have been announced on Monday.
The one time only program was introduced after a majority of grade 12 students performed poorly in the 2022 Ethiopian University Entrance Exam.
The 29,909 students who managed to score 50% and above will directly join public higher education institutions.
Others with a relatively better score are also given a lifeline to enter public universities based on the slots available.
These students will, however, go through a remedial program and will be tested to continue pursuing their education in the university.
The ministry of Education announced the cut off points to enter either public or private universities through the Program.
Accordingly, a student has to score a minimum of 30% points in the national exam to follow higher education.
